Patent number: 11781359Abstract: A low-bulkiness hinge for closing a closing element anchored to a stationary support structure, such as a wall, a frame or a floor includes a hinge body which includes a longitudinal operating chamber defining a first axis, a pivot coupled to the hinge body to rotate around a second axis between the opening and closing positions of the closing element, and a slider slidable in the operating chamber along the first axis. The operating chamber has a first seat for the pivot and a second seat for the sliding of the slider, which includes a shaft and an operative head that are mutually coupled. The hinge body has a first opening for inserting, perpendicularly to the first axis, the operative head into the second seat and a second through opening for inserting, coaxially to the first axis, the shaft into the housing. The hinge further has the shaft and the operative head fixed to one another after insertion in the second seat (so as to form a unitary assembly integrally slidable along the first axis.Type: GrantFiled: July 3, 2020Date of Patent: October 10, 2023Inventor: Luciano Bacchetti

Patent number: 11766097Abstract: A buckle may include male and female parts. In a case (A) where only the female part is attached to a slider of a slide fastener, the male part includes: a pair of arms respectively provided with locking protrusions; and a connecting rod connecting respective base ends of the pair of arms. The connecting rod is configured to curve away from a space between the locking protrusions of the arms when the arms are bent such that the locking protrusions approach one another. In a case (B) where the male part is attached to a slider of a slide fastener, the male part includes: a slider-holding frame configured to hold the slider; and a pair of arms that extend in the same direction from the slider-holding frame and are respectively provided with locking protrusions. The slider-holding frame includes a frame portion protruded into a space between the pair of arms toward a space between the locking protrusions.Type: GrantFiled: August 21, 2020Date of Patent: September 26, 2023Assignee: YKK CorporationInventors: Naoyuki Ito, Ryoichiro Takazakura, Tomoko Yagami

Patent number: 11713604Abstract: A door stop mechanisms is disclosed that is arranged for preventing a door from swinging back against a wall. The door stop mechanisms are flexible, wall mounted door stops to absorb the impact of the swinging door or other mechanisms imparting a sideways force. The door stops are also arranged to absorb the force, flex, and return, without damage to the mechanism. One embodiment of a door stop mechanism, according to the present invention comprises a bottom portion having a bottom hollow section and a top portion on the bottom portion. The top portion has a top hollow section facing the bottom hollow section. A spring is arranged in the top and bottom hollow sections. A first end of the spring is attached to the top portion and a second end of the spring is attached to the bottom portion. The spring holds the top portion to the bottom portion in alignment while also allowing the top portion to move in relation to the bottom portion in response to a force.Type: GrantFiled: October 19, 2020Date of Patent: August 1, 2023Inventor: Kurt R. Linden

Patent number: 11680601Abstract: A hinge includes a base frame unit and a rotating unit. The base frame unit includes a base seat having two rotating recesses and a transmitting recess, and two interfering plates respectively disposed in the rotating recesses. The rotating unit includes two rotating members respectively and rotatably disposed in the rotating recesses, and a bevel gear member disposed in the transmitting recess. Each rotating member frictionally interferes with the respective interfering plate, and has a bevel gear portion meshing with the bevel gear member. A torque generated as a result of rotation of one rotating member is transmitted through the bevel gear member to rotate the other rotating member relative to the base seat so as to make stable synchronous rotation of the rotating members.Type: GrantFiled: February 23, 2022Date of Patent: June 20, 2023Assignee: FOSITEK CORPORATIONInventor: Hsu-Hong Yao
